“93 for 93” – Celebrate 93 Years of Excellence
With the 2011 Annual Meeting, the NFHS will celebrate its 93rd year since the states recognized the need to work together. In that same spirit of cooperation, the NFHS is seeking your help in building the NFHS Foundation. The mission of the Foundation is to promote the development of citizenship skills among young student-athletes, as well as to reduce the risks of participation in high school sports.
We seek your support for the Foundation by participating in this year’s “93 for 93” campaign.
We are asking individuals and businesses to contribute $93 to the Foundation in the NFHS’ 93rd year of existence. In addition, we are asking our member states to contribute to the Foundation in denominations of the 93 theme, such as $930 or $9,300. Golf Tournament
The NFHS Foundation Golf Tournament is one of the annual fundraising activities of the Foundation. Golfers play in foursomes for several great prizes. Always held at one of the best courses in the nation, the scramble format allows golfers at every level to enjoy the game. Transportation, refreshments and gifts are provided to all participants.
 
Bowling Tournament
The NFHS Foundation Bowling Tournament is a popular and fun fundraising event in which all skill levels can compete. Prizes are awarded to the top team and high individual score for men and women.
 
Fun Run
Runners and walkers get their shoes on and come out to support the Foundation in this 5K event. Always a great event, the fun/run walk is a timed event with trophies awarded to the top two males and top two females. Participants will receive a commemorative race t-shirt.
 
Silent Auction
The biggest fundraiser for the NFHS Foundation, the Silent Auction features various unique objects from across the country. Articles are donated from all 51 state associations, businesses and partnering organizations and include many sports memorabilia collectors’ items. Auction items are on display beginning at the Opening Reception of the Summer Meeting for you to make your winning bids.
